Let's take a quick look at the latest, 00Z-8PM EDT, RAOB or weather balloon observations from the Eastern Caribbean.
TJSJ-San Juan, P.R. PRES HGHT TEMP DEWP RH DD WETB DIR SPD mb m____C___C__%___C__C deg_ knt 850 1543 16.4 14.5 89 1.9 15.1 035 3kt 700 3173 8.2 -2.8 46 11.0 2.7 350 10kt 500 5880 -7.3 -22.3 29 15.0 -11.9 355 11kt
So winds vary from the NNE at 3kt at 5000ft to NNW at 11kt at 18000ft. Relative Humidity drops from 89% at 5000ft to 29% at 18000ft.
TFFR-Pointe-a-Pitre - Le Raizet, Guadeloupe 850 1542 16.2 12.6 79 3.6 13.8 095 6kt 700 3175 8.2 -3.8 42 12.0 2.3 190 7kt 500 5880 -5.9 -21.9 27 16.0 -11.0 345 6kt
Here we have a good bit of directional shear in place. 5000ft ESE at 6kt. 10000ft SSW at 7 kt 18000ft NNW at 6kt.
Relative Humidity drops from 79% at 5000ft to 27% at 18000ft. In both of the above cases there is dry air aloft.
The RAOB or weather balloon observations from TTPP-Piarco International Airport, Trinidad, Trinidad and Tobago and TBPB-Grantley Adams, Barbados were from 8AM EDT this morning.
